That’s right, tennis fever is set to grip Britain once again for a fortnight as Wimbledon - the world’s oldest tennis tournament - gets underway on Monday (29 June). The Championships are regarded as the sport's most prestigious competition, with an impressive roll call of tennis elite having lifted the trophy on finals day over its 138 year history.
